The tradition continues this Sunday, March 1st, 2009 - opening day of trout season at Bennett Spring State Park in Lebanon Missouri. Last year, the Park played host to 3,000 anglers on opening day, a Saturday. This year, Park officials expect the same, if not a few more. The weathermen are (1 comments)

Lebanon Missouri played host today to their Annual Christmas Parade. The Saturday before Thanksgiving traditionally kicks off the holiday season in Lebanon and Laclede County. The theme for the 2008 parade: Believe in the Spirit of Christmas.The Laclede Country R-1 Marching Band (Conway Missouri) was one of over one hundred entries (9 comments)

Lebanon Missouri played host to the 8th Annual Route 66 Festival on Saturday, September 20th, 2008. The event actually kicked off on Friday night with a Cruise-In sponsored by Steak-n-Shake of Lebanon.
